Output 61a3cacc3fea292a607068f4f153453604b65ac663ea663e5e754aa0873c20ef:25

value
8395041
script pubkey
OP_0 OP_PUSHBYTES_20 6b0e5738ae1c9c42013127a29e79e1b17bf0da47
address
bc1qdv89ww9wrjwyyqf3y73fu70pk9alpkj8frmzyy
transaction
61a3cacc3fea292a607068f4f153453604b65ac663ea663e5e754aa0873c20ef